In Short : India’s rooftop solar initiative is projected to cut 720 million tonnes of CO₂ emissions and benefit one crore households, according to MoS Bhupender Yadav Naik. The program aims to expand residential solar adoption, enhance energy access, and strengthen India’s climate action efforts. By promoting distributed solar, it supports sustainable energy growth and the country’s transition to a low-carbon future.

In Detail : India’s rooftop solar initiative is poised to make a significant impact on the country’s energy and environmental landscape. According to Minister of State Bhupender Yadav Naik, the program is expected to cut 720 million tonnes of CO₂ emissions, contributing meaningfully to India’s climate targets and net-zero goals.

The initiative aims to empower one crore households by providing access to clean, reliable, and affordable energy. By promoting rooftop solar installations at the residential level, the program supports energy self-sufficiency and reduces dependence on conventional fossil fuel-based electricity.

The government has designed the program to facilitate easy adoption of rooftop solar systems. Subsidies, incentives, and streamlined approval processes are being implemented to encourage homeowners to participate and contribute to the national clean energy transition.

Distributed solar energy generation also enhances grid stability. By producing electricity closer to consumption points, rooftop systems reduce transmission losses, ease grid load, and allow for more efficient integration of renewable energy into India’s power network.

The initiative aligns with India’s broader renewable energy goals, including the target of achieving 500 GW of non-fossil fuel-based capacity by 2030. Residential rooftop solar is a key component of this strategy, complementing large-scale solar parks and industrial solar adoption.

The program is expected to create employment opportunities in solar manufacturing, installation, maintenance, and related services. By fostering local skills development, it contributes to economic growth while simultaneously advancing environmental sustainability objectives.

Awareness campaigns and community engagement are central to the initiative’s success. Educational efforts help residents understand the financial and environmental benefits of rooftop solar, encouraging widespread adoption and ensuring long-term program effectiveness.

Technological innovations, including battery storage integration and smart metering, are being promoted alongside rooftop solar installations. These advancements enhance reliability, allow for round-the-clock energy supply, and optimize energy management at the household level.
